Search
Preparing search index...
The search index is not available
Ews JavaScript Api
Options
All
Public
Public/Protected
All
Inherited
Only exported
Menu
Globals
HangingServiceRequestBase
Class HangingServiceRequestBase
Not Implemented
Hierarchy
ServiceRequestBase
HangingServiceRequestBase
GetStreamingEventsRequest
Index
Constructors
constructor
Properties
Anchor
Mailbox
Is
Connected
On
Disconnect
Soap
Fault
Details
heartbeat
Frequency
Milliseconds
lock
Object
request
response
response
Handler
Buffer
Size
Log
All
Wire
Bytes
Accessors
Emit
Time
Zone
Header
Service
Methods
Add
Headers
Build
Response
Object
From
Json
BuildXHR
Disconnect
Emit
Request
Get
Ews
Http
Web
Response
Get
Minimum
Required
Server
Version
Get
Requested
Service
Version
String
Get
Response
Xml
Element
Name
Get
Xml
Element
Name
Internal
Execute
Internal
OnConnect
Internal
OnDisconnect
Parse
Response
Parse
Responses
Process
Web
Exception
Read
Preamble
Read
Response
Xml
JsObject
Read
Soap
Fault
Read
Soap
Header
Throw
IfNot
Supported
ByRequested
Server
Version
Validate
Validate
And
Emit
Request
Write
Attributes
ToXml
Write
Body
ToXml
Write
Elements
ToXml
Write
ToXml
Constructors
constructor
new
Hanging
Service
Request
Base
(
service
:
ExchangeService
)
:
HangingServiceRequestBase
Parameters
service:
ExchangeService
Returns
HangingServiceRequestBase
Properties
Anchor
Mailbox
Anchor
Mailbox
:
string
Is
Connected
Is
Connected
:
boolean
Private
On
Disconnect
On
Disconnect
:
HangingRequestDisconnectHandler
Soap
Fault
Details
Soap
Fault
Details
:
SoapFaultDetails
heartbeat
Frequency
Milliseconds
heartbeat
Frequency
Milliseconds
:
number
Private
lock
Object
lock
Object
:
any
Private
request
request
:
IEwsHttpWebRequest
Private
response
response
:
IEwsHttpWebResponse
Private
response
Handler
response
Handler
:
HandleResponseObject
Static
Private
Buffer
Size
Buffer
Size
:
number
Static
Log
All
Wire
Bytes
Log
All
Wire
Bytes
:
boolean
Accessors
Emit
Time
Zone
Header
get
EmitTimeZoneHeader
(
)
:
boolean
Returns
boolean
Service
get
Service
(
)
:
ExchangeService
Returns
ExchangeService
Methods
Add
Headers
Add
Headers
(
webHeaderCollection
:
any
)
:
void
Parameters
webHeaderCollection:
any
Returns
void
Build
Response
Object
From
Json
Build
Response
Object
From
Json
(
jsObject
:
any
)
:
any
Parameters
jsObject:
any
Returns
any
BuildXHR
BuildXHR
(
)
:
IXHROptions
Returns
IXHROptions
Disconnect
Disconnect
(
)
:
void
Returns
void
Emit
Request
Emit
Request
(
request
:
IXHROptions
)
:
void
Parameters
request:
IXHROptions
Returns
void
Get
Ews
Http
Web
Response
Get
Ews
Http
Web
Response
(
request
:
IXHROptions
)
:
IPromise
<
XMLHttpRequest
>
Parameters
request:
IXHROptions
Returns
IPromise
<
XMLHttpRequest
>
Get
Minimum
Required
Server
Version
Get
Minimum
Required
Server
Version
(
)
:
ExchangeVersion
Returns
ExchangeVersion
Get
Requested
Service
Version
String
Get
Requested
Service
Version
String
(
)
:
string
Returns
string
Get
Response
Xml
Element
Name
Get
Response
Xml
Element
Name
(
)
:
string
Returns
string
Get
Xml
Element
Name
Get
Xml
Element
Name
(
)
:
string
Returns
string
Internal
Execute
Internal
Execute
(
)
:
void
Returns
void
Internal
OnConnect
Internal
OnConnect
(
)
:
void
Returns
void
Internal
OnDisconnect
Internal
OnDisconnect
(
reason
:
HangingRequestDisconnectReason
, exception
:
Exception
)
:
void
Parameters
reason:
HangingRequestDisconnectReason
exception:
Exception
Returns
void
Parse
Response
Parse
Response
(
jsonBody
:
any
)
:
any
Parameters
jsonBody:
any
Returns
any
Parse
Responses
Parse
Responses
(
state
:
any
)
:
void
Parameters
state:
any
Returns
void
Protected
Process
Web
Exception
Process
Web
Exception
(
webException
:
XMLHttpRequest
)
:
void
Parameters
webException:
XMLHttpRequest
Returns
void
Read
Preamble
Read
Preamble
(
ewsXmlReader
:
EwsServiceXmlReader
)
:
void
Parameters
ewsXmlReader:
EwsServiceXmlReader
Returns
void
Protected
Read
Response
Xml
JsObject
Read
Response
Xml
JsObject
(
jsObject
:
any
)
:
any
Parameters
jsObject:
any
Returns
any
Read
Soap
Fault
Read
Soap
Fault
(
reader
:
EwsServiceXmlReader
)
:
SoapFaultDetails
Parameters
reader:
EwsServiceXmlReader
Returns
SoapFaultDetails
Read
Soap
Header
Read
Soap
Header
(
jsObject
:
any
)
:
any
Parameters
jsObject:
any
Returns
any
Throw
IfNot
Supported
ByRequested
Server
Version
Throw
IfNot
Supported
ByRequested
Server
Version
(
)
:
void
Returns
void
Validate
Validate
(
)
:
void
Returns
void
Validate
And
Emit
Request
Validate
And
Emit
Request
(
request
:
IXHROptions
)
:
IPromise
<
XMLHttpRequest
>
Parameters
request:
IXHROptions
Returns
IPromise
<
XMLHttpRequest
>
Write
Attributes
ToXml
Write
Attributes
ToXml
(
writer
:
EwsServiceXmlWriter
)
:
void
Parameters
writer:
EwsServiceXmlWriter
Returns
void
Write
Body
ToXml
Write
Body
ToXml
(
writer
:
EwsServiceXmlWriter
)
:
void
Parameters
writer:
EwsServiceXmlWriter
Returns
void
Write
Elements
ToXml
Write
Elements
ToXml
(
writer
:
EwsServiceXmlWriter
)
:
any
Parameters
writer:
EwsServiceXmlWriter
Returns
any
Write
ToXml
Write
ToXml
(
writer
:
EwsServiceXmlWriter
)
:
void
Parameters
writer:
EwsServiceXmlWriter
Returns
void
Globals
Hanging
Service
Request
Base
constructor
Anchor
Mailbox
Is
Connected
On
Disconnect
Soap
Fault
Details
heartbeat
Frequency
Milliseconds
lock
Object
request
response
response
Handler
Buffer
Size
Log
All
Wire
Bytes
Emit
Time
Zone
Header
Service
Add
Headers
Build
Response
Object
From
Json
BuildXHR
Disconnect
Emit
Request
Get
Ews
Http
Web
Response
Get
Minimum
Required
Server
Version
Get
Requested
Service
Version
String
Get
Response
Xml
Element
Name
Get
Xml
Element
Name
Internal
Execute
Internal
OnConnect
Internal
OnDisconnect
Parse
Response
Parse
Responses
Process
Web
Exception
Read
Preamble
Read
Response
Xml
JsObject
Read
Soap
Fault
Read
Soap
Header
Throw
IfNot
Supported
ByRequested
Server
Version
Validate
Validate
And
Emit
Request
Write
Attributes
ToXml
Write
Body
ToXml
Write
Elements
ToXml
Write
ToXml
Generated using
TypeDoc
Not Implemented